Add 63/4 and 63/15
1st number: 15 3/4, 2nd number: 4 3/15
63/4 + 63/15 is 399/20.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 4 and 15 is 60
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 60 - For the 1st fraction, since 4 × 15 = 60,
63/4 = 63 × 15/4 × 15 = 945/60 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 15 × 4 = 60,
63/15 = 63 × 4/15 × 4 = 252/60 - Add the two like fractions:
945/60 + 252/60 = 945 + 252/60 = 1197/60 - 1197/60 simplified gives 399/20
- So, 63/4 + 63/15 = 399/20
